--- rpms/initscripts/sme9/initscripts.spec 2015/09/30 10:01:17 1.12 +++ rpms/initscripts/sme9/initscripts.spec 2016/06/15 05:16:09 1.13 @@ -2,13 +2,18 @@ Summary: The inittab file and the /etc/init.d scripts Name: initscripts -Version: 9.03.49 +Version: 9.03.53 # ppp-watch is GPLv2+, everything else is GPLv2 License: GPLv2 and GPLv2+ Group: System Environment/Base -Release: 1%{?dist}.1.1 +Release: 1%{?dist}.1 URL: http://fedorahosted.org/releases/i/n/initscripts/ Source: http://fedorahosted.org/releases/i/n/initscripts/initscripts-%{version}.tar.bz2 +Patch1000: centos-initscripts.patch +Patch2000: initscripts-9.03.31-runlevel7.patch +Patch2001: initscripts-9.03.40-dmesg.patch +Patch2002: initscripts-9.03.40-slapd_alias_ldap.patch +Patch2003: initscripts-9.03.46-dont_run_plymouth_if_disabled.patch B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root Requires: mingetty, /bin/awk, /bin/sed, mktemp Requires: /sbin/sysctl @@ -28,6 +33,7 @@ Requires: /etc/system-release Requires: ethtool >= 1.8-2, /sbin/runuser Requires: udev >= 125-1 Requires: cpio +Requires: plymouth Conflicts: mkinitrd < 4.0, kernel < 2.6.18, mdadm < 3.1.2-9 Conflicts: ypbind < 1.6-12, psacct < 6.3.2-12, kbd < 1.06-19, lokkit < 0.50-14 Conflicts: dhclient < 12:4.1.0-6 @@ -46,16 +52,10 @@ Requires(pre): /usr/sbin/groupadd Requires(post): /sbin/chkconfig, coreutils Requires(preun): /sbin/chkconfig BuildRequires: glib2-devel popt-devel gettext pkgconfig -Patch1: 0001-rc.sysinit-apply-quotas-after-system-is-relabeled.patch -Patch1000: centos-initscripts.patch -Patch2000: initscripts-9.03.31-runlevel7.patch -Patch2001: initscripts-9.03.40-dmesg.patch -Patch2002: initscripts-9.03.40-slapd_alias_ldap.patch -Patch2003: initscripts-9.03.46-dont_run_plymouth_if_disabled.patch %description The initscripts package contains the basic system scripts used to boot -your SME Server system, change runlevels, and shut the system down +your Koozali SME Server system, change runlevels, and shut the system down cleanly. Initscripts also contains the scripts that activate and deactivate most network interfaces. @@ -73,8 +73,7 @@ Currently, this consists of various memo %prep %setup -q -%patch1 -p1 -%patch1000 -p1 +%patch1000 -p1 -b .centos.branding %patch2000 -p1 %patch2001 -p1 %patch2002 -p1 @@ -211,6 +210,7 @@ rm -rf $RPM_BUILD_ROOT %config(noreplace) /etc/rc.d/rc.local /etc/rc.d/rc.sysinit %config(noreplace) /etc/sysctl.conf +%dir /etc/sysctl.d %exclude /etc/profile.d/debug* /etc/profile.d/* /usr/sbin/sys-unconfig @@ -259,13 +259,45 @@ rm -rf $RPM_BUILD_ROOT /etc/profile.d/debug* %changelog -* Wed Sep 30 2015 Daniel Berteaud - 9.03.49-1.sme.1.1 -- Rebase on upstream 9.03.49 [SME: 9081] +* Wed Jun 15 2016 Daniel Berteaud - 9.03.53-1.sme.1 +- Rebase on upstream 9.03.53-1 [SME: 9534] -* Tue Sep 22 2015 Johnny Hughes - 9.03.49-1.centos.1 +* Tue May 10 2016 Johnny Hughes - 9.03.53-1 - Roll in CentOS Branding -* Thu Aug 13 2015 Lukáš Nykrýn - 9.03.49-1.1 +* Tue Apr 12 2016 Lukáš Nykrýn - 9.03.53-1 +- functions: parse -d first + +* Mon Apr 11 2016 Lukáš Nykrýn - 9.03.52-1 +- functions: fix ignored delay in killproc + +* Tue Feb 23 2016 Lukáš Nykrýn - 9.03.51-1 +- netfs: only unmount loopback device mounted on top of netdev or with back-file on netdev + +* Tue Jan 19 2016 Lukáš Nykrýn - 9.03.50-1 +- functions: improve killing loops +- netfs: tweak nfs umount +- sysctl.conf: mention sysctl -a +- sysconfig.txt: document PPPOE_EXTRA and PPPD_EXTRA +- spec: require plymouth +- fix mangled sysconfig/init.s390 +- rc.sysinit: don't perform fsck twice with /.autorelabel +- ifdown-eth: fix comparison +- ifup-eth: if arping fails, output responding MAC +- network-functions: fix change_resolv_conf after grep update +- spec: add sysctl.d dir +- rc.sysinit: fix typo in fs +- rename_devices: comments need to have a blank before them +- rename_device: remove comments and trailing whitespaces +- bonding: warn if the ifup for slave device failed +- clarify daemon() usage message +- ifdown: clean ipv4 localhost addresses +- ifup-post: check resolve.conf also with DNS2 +- ifup: add missing quotes +- ifup-eth: some bridge options are applied later +- init.d/halt: give init some time to reexecute +- network-scripts: DEVICE and HWADRR could be quoted by apostrophe +- ifup-wireless: fix calling of phy_wireless_device - rc.sysinit: apply quotas after system is relabeled * Thu Apr 09 2015 Lukáš Nykrýn - 9.03.49-1